How they compare
Finland currently reports 898,161 current LCU per square kilometre against 795,668 current LCU per square kilometre in Suriname, a difference of 102,493 current LCU per square kilometre.
That makes Finland's figure about 1.1 times Suriname's.
Across all 63 years both countries report, Finland has been ahead every year.
Finland ranks 180th and Suriname ranks 183rd of 210 countries.
Finland has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

About this data
GDP (current LCU)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
